American Modern Insurance Group, Inc., a Munich Re company, is a widely recognized specialty insurance leader that delivers products and services for residential property – such as manufactured homes and specialty dwellings – and the recreational market, including boats, personal watercraft, classic cars, and more. We provide specialty product solutions that cover what the competition often can’t. We write admitted products in all 50 states and have a premium volume of $2.2 billion.
Headquartered in Amelia, Ohio, and with associates located across the United States, we are part of Munich Re’s Global Specialty Insurance division. Munich Re is one of the world’s leading providers of reinsurance, primary insurance and insurance-related risk solutions. The group consists of the reinsurance and ERGO business segments, as well as the capital investment company MEAG. We are globally active and operate in all lines of the insurance business.
Since our founding in 1880, we’ve been known for our unrivaled risk-related expertise and sound financial position. We offer customers financial protection when faced with exceptional levels of damage – from the 1906 San Francisco earthquake to the 2017 Atlantic hurricane season. We possess outstanding innovative strength, which enables us to also provide coverage for extraordinary risks such as rocket launches, renewable energies, cyber attacks, or pandemics.
